One day trip to Gaganachukki & Bharachukki falls and Keshava temple (Somnathpur)

It was a short one day trip on a saturday. Started by around 5:30AM from Bangalore (MG Road) and we reached MG Road again by 8:00PM.

Thanks to hotstuff for his help with directions. Just after Maddur, we took the left to Malavali. The road till Malavali was not great and certain stretch was bad. We could not travel at more than 30-40KM/hr. From Malavali till Ganaganchukki, the road was good. It was newly laid I think. The journey from Maddur to Gaganachukki took close to 90 minutes. We reached Gaganachukki by 8:30AM. Though the waterfalls was not at its best (as I have seen in few other photos), still it looked good. There was not much of crowd when we went, but before we could return, lot of school children arrived by then. We spent close to an hour. Some photos I took on the way and in Gaganachukki.

Bharachukki waterfalls

We then started the journey to Bharachukki. The road until Belakavadi was good and thereafter it started to deteriorate. For few meters, there were no roads. 1 or 2 KM before the waterfalls, couple of guys stopped and asked Rs.50 as the entrance fee for the car. They definitely did not look like a government posted personnel and tickets looked fake. We argued for some time and they did allow us without paying any money. I am not sure if anyone encountered this.

We spent two and a half hours. We even took the coracle ride to spot where the water falls. This person charged Rs. 100 for the ride.

By 11:30AM we started the drive to Somnathpur. I took the left turn soon after the bridge near Belakavadi. I drove through 39KM distance with virtually no roads. The needle on the speedometer did not cross 25KM/HR for 98% of the distance. We covered this distance in two hours time or it may have taken more than that. But the route was beautiful in its own ways. There were lot of green rice fields. For the distance until sky touched the ground, we could see just green rice fields. Finally we reached Somnathpur and had our sandwiches that we packed at home.

The Keshava temple was very good with intricate and very detailed carvings. No doubt Maniratnam chose this magnificient temple to shoot the song "Sundari" in the superhit movie starring Rajinikanth, Mammootty and Shobana. There were lot of tourists including school childrens on this place. The temple is open to visitors from 9:00AM to 5:00PM. ASI collects Rs. 5 per person as entrance ticket charge.

Keshava Temple and way back to Bangalore

We started the return trip by 4:30PM and we took the route to Bangalore via Bannur-> Mandya. The Somnathpur-> Bannur-> Mandya road condition was no different to the one between Belakavadi to Somnathpur. The road conditions were equally bad. We managed to reach MG Road by 8:00PM. At the end it was a very well spent day.
